In Bayonetta 3, the forces of heaven and hell give way to invaders from parallel dimensions – creatures of bone and emerald, led by a gloating Thanos-style spectre who is killing off all Bayonetta’s alternate selves (read: wardrobe changes) in order to blend every universe into one. Bayonetta’s pet devils aren’t under contract to devour these newcomers, so rather than conjuring them as QTE finishers she must summon them fully and take control – aconcept gleaned from Platinum’s Astral Chain and the abandoned Scalebound, which stretches the already-confounding spectacle of Bayonetta combat to shattering point.
